Does it still work? e.g. a level 70 runs unteamed with a level 5, level 5 taps a mob, level 70 blasts it, level 5 gets mad xp.

Any version of this still work?
This won't work, as the level five would only get the proportion of the damage that they did to the mob. For instance, if the mob was worth 20 points, and the level five hit it for one tenth of its hit points, the level five would only get two points, the rest would be wasted. There are two ways around this that still work.

1. Have the high level char be of the opposite faction. A level 70 Horde toon blasting a mob that a level 5 Alliance toon tapped, would result in full experience for the level five, as if he killed it completely by himself.

2. Have the level five paired with another toon of similar level, and have a high level toon with a pet be unpartied following along. One of the low level toons taps a mob, the pet finishes it off, the pair get full experience. This won't work with a solo character, needs to be at least a party of two. This works great for mult-boxers, but make sure that the hunter/warlock/death knight controlling the pet doesn't do any damage themselves. I flip up to a bare action bar to make sure.
